AGE-RELATED MACULAR DEGENERATION (AMD) TREATMENT & PRIVATE SCREENING SERVICE
Age-related macular degeneration (AMD) is common after the age of 50, though it can happen earlier. The risk of developing AMD increases with age. The prevalence goes up from 1/ 200 at 60 to 1/5 at 90.

Vitreous Floaters
Patients with an acute onset of floaters need to undergo a Full Retinal Examination through dilated pupils that includes Biomicroscopy and Indirect Ophthalmoscopy with Scleral indentation to rule out Retinal tears or Retinal detachment.
CATARACTS
The normal function of the lens in your eye is to focus light so that you can see clear, sharp images. When a cataract occurs, the lens inside your eye becomes cloudy making it difficult to see well enough to carry out your daily activities.
